BUENOS AIRES & IGUAZÚ FALLS
Let yourself be charmed and surprised by the city on this 4 day tour of Buenos Aires and its surrounding areas. Nothing better than combining this amazing city with the Iguazu Falls; without doubt one of the most spectacular natural attractions in South America, if not the world. Shared between Argentina and Brazil.
Day 1
Buenos Aires

Upon arrival in Buenos Aires, you will be transferred to your hotel before exploring the city at your own pace.
At night, try a typical Argentine dish in one of the many restaurants that the city has to offer.
Day 2
City tour, dinner and tango show

Breakfast. Our private city tour provides an overview of the city and its attractions. During this three hour tour, you will visit Retiro, Avenida 9 de Julio (El Teatro Colon and Obelisco), the Center (Congress, Plaza de Mayo, Avenida de Mayo, Casa Rosada), Puerto Madero and San Telmo with stops in Recoleta (Cemetery and Plaza Francia) and La Boca (Caminito).
At night you will enjoy a delicious meal and a tango show, before being transferred to your hotel.
Day 3
Buenos Aires – Puerto Iguazú.

Breakfast. Transfer to airport for flight to Puerto Iguazú.
Upon arrival in Puerto Iguazú, you will be transferred in private service to your selected hotel where you will have the rest of the day free to enjoy the pool. In the evening you may visit the Three Borders Landmark, located in the tri-border area between Argentina, Brazil and Paraguay.
Day 4
Puerto Iguazú, excursion to Argentinian Falls.

After breakfast, start the full day private excursion with a trip to the Argentine side of Iguazu Falls. Explore the National Park by wandering its paths to take in the incredible views of 200 waterfalls. Lunch is at noon, after which you can take the optional Great Adventure tour that allows you to examine the falls up close, and even takes you underneath! In the afternoon, catch the train to the largest of the park’s attractions, the Devil’s Throat. In the afternoon you will be transferred to hotel.
Day 5
Puerto Iguazú, excursion to Brazilian Falls

After breakfast, a half day private excursion takes you to the Brazilian side of the Iguazu Falls, where you will be treated to panoramic views of the falls visited the previous day. In the afternoon, you will be transferred in a regular service to the airport for your flight to Buenos Aires. Transfer to hotel (private service).
Day 6
Buenos Aires

Breakfast, after which you will be transferred to the international airport for your return flight.
